Overview
Broom Hall Inn provides cosy 3-star accommodation in Bidford-on-Avon. It is conveniently located for those wanting to visit local attractions.
This historic inn provides a range of amenities, such as a garden, a terrace and wireless internet.
Broom Hall Inn features spacious rooms equipped with a hair dryer, plus all the essentials to ensure a comfortable stay.
Broom Hall Inn's premium amenities comprise a traditional bar and an in-house restaurant.
The inn is under a 45-minute drive from Birmingham Airport. Stratford-upon-Avon Canal and Cotswolds can be easily accessed by car.

What are the unique features of Broom Hall Inn's historic building?
The hotel is steeped in history, built in 1577, and features beautiful beams and original features that have been sympathetically restored. The building provides a lovely experience from start to finish, with a warm and welcoming atmosphere.
